Diverse Modules for Critical Thinking

We offer a wide array of problem-solving team building programs to suit different organizational needs. For those who enjoy a physical and mental challenge, our 'Engineering Feats' module requires teams to build complex structures with limited resources. For a more analytical approach, our 'Strategic Simulations' place teams in a competitive market scenario where they must make data-driven decisions. These problem-solving team building programs are designed to be both fun and intellectually stimulating. Another favorite in Nairobi is our 'Escape the Boardroom' series, which uses puzzles and riddles to unlock the next stage of the mission. These problem-solving team building programs are excellent for identifying natural leaders and improving time management. We also offer 'Social Impact Challenges,' where teams must brainstorm solutions to real-world community issues in Nairobi, fostering both problem-solving skills and corporate social responsibility. Every one of our problem-solving team building programs is fully customizable, allowing us to align the challenges with your specific industry or internal goals.

Building Resilience and Adaptability in Teams

A group of employees looking focused while solving a riddle

The ability to bounce back from failure is a hallmark of a great team. Our programs include challenges that are intentionally difficult, requiring teams to iterate and try new approaches when their first attempt fails. This builds resilience and a 'growth mindset' within your Nairobi workforce. We teach participants how to conduct 'post-mortems' on their performance, identifying what went wrong and how to improve. This reflective practice is essential for continuous improvement in any business. By experiencing the frustration of a difficult challenge and the triumph of eventually overcoming it, teams develop a stronger bond and a shared sense of accomplishment. This emotional journey is a powerful tool for building a more unified and determined team.

How do you handle teams that get stuck during a challenge?
Our facilitators are trained to provide 'just-in-time' coaching. We don't give away the answers, but we ask the right questions to help the team refocus and find their own way forward. Getting 'stuck' is actually a valuable part of the learning process, as it forces the team to re-evaluate their strategy and improve their communication. We ensure that every team feels supported while still being challenged.
